
化工行业的数据挖掘分析可以从多个方面进行,如数据收集、数据预处理、特征选择、模型选择、结果分析和优化。其中,数据收集是最为基础和关键的一步,数据的质量直接决定了后续分析的准确性和有效性。在数据收集过程中,可以通过传感器、数据库、实验数据等多种途径获取相关信息,并对数据进行初步清洗和处理,以确保数据的完整性和准确性。数据预处理包括数据清洗、数据变换、数据规约等步骤,可以提高数据的质量和分析的效率。特征选择是从原始数据中提取有用的信息,减少数据维度,提高模型的性能。模型选择则是根据具体的分析目标和数据特点,选择合适的算法进行建模。结果分析是对模型的输出进行解释和评估,以验证模型的有效性和实用性。优化是根据分析结果,对生产工艺、流程等进行调整和改进,以提高生产效率和产品质量。
一、数据收集
数据收集是化工行业数据挖掘分析的第一步,也是最为基础和关键的一步。高质量的数据是进行准确分析的前提。在化工行业中,数据来源广泛,包括生产设备上的传感器数据、实验室的实验数据、企业内部的生产数据库、市场的销售数据等。为了确保数据的全面性和准确性,需要采用多种手段进行数据收集。
传感器数据是化工生产过程中最重要的数据来源之一。现代化的化工生产设备通常都配备了各种传感器,用于实时监测生产过程中的温度、压力、流量、组成等参数。这些传感器数据可以通过工业互联网或物联网技术实时传输到数据中心,进行存储和分析。
实验数据是化工行业中另一个重要的数据来源。化工实验室通常会进行各种化学反应、材料合成、性能测试等实验,产生大量的实验数据。这些数据可以通过实验管理系统进行记录和管理,为数据挖掘分析提供重要的支持。
企业内部的生产数据库通常包含了生产计划、原料采购、产品销售、设备维护等各方面的数据。这些数据可以通过企业资源计划(ERP)系统进行管理,为数据挖掘分析提供全面的信息支持。
市场销售数据则是化工产品在市场上的销售情况,包括销售量、价格、客户反馈等。这些数据可以通过市场调研、客户关系管理(CRM)系统等途径获取,为数据挖掘分析提供市场需求和客户行为的相关信息。
二、数据预处理
数据预处理是数据挖掘分析中必不可少的一步。高质量的数据可以显著提高分析的准确性和效率。数据预处理包括数据清洗、数据变换和数据规约等步骤。
数据清洗是指对收集到的原始数据进行检查和处理,去除其中的噪声、错误和缺失值。在化工行业的数据中,传感器数据可能会受到环境干扰、设备故障等因素的影响,出现异常值或缺失值。通过数据清洗,可以将这些异常值和缺失值进行处理或填补,保证数据的完整性和准确性。
数据变换是指对数据进行一定的变换和转换,使其更适合于后续的分析。常见的数据变换方法包括标准化、归一化、离散化等。标准化是指将数据转换为均值为0,标准差为1的标准正态分布;归一化是指将数据转换为0到1之间的数值;离散化是指将连续型数据转换为离散型数据。这些变换方法可以使数据更易于分析和处理。
数据规约是指在保证数据重要信息不丢失的前提下,减少数据的维度和规模。常见的数据规约方法包括主成分分析(PCA)、特征选择、样本选择等。通过数据规约,可以减少数据的冗余,提高分析的效率和模型的性能。
三、特征选择
特征选择是从原始数据中提取有用的信息,减少数据维度,提高模型性能的重要步骤。在化工行业的数据中,通常包含了大量的变量和特征,其中有些特征对分析目标有重要影响,有些则可能是冗余或噪声。通过特征选择,可以筛选出对分析目标有显著影响的特征,提高模型的准确性和解释性。
特征选择的方法主要有三类:过滤法、包裹法和嵌入法。过滤法是指根据特征与目标变量的相关性或统计特性进行筛选,如卡方检验、互信息、皮尔逊相关系数等。包裹法是指将特征选择作为模型训练的一部分,通过模型的性能来评估特征的好坏,如递归特征消除(RFE)、前向选择、后向消除等。嵌入法是指在模型训练过程中自动进行特征选择,如Lasso回归、决策树等。
在化工行业的数据挖掘分析中,可以根据具体的分析目标和数据特点选择合适的特征选择方法。例如,在化工反应的动力学分析中,可以选择反应物浓度、温度、压力等与反应速率相关的特征;在产品质量的预测中,可以选择原料成分、生产工艺参数、设备状态等与产品性能相关的特征。
四、模型选择
模型选择是数据挖掘分析中关键的一步。根据具体的分析目标和数据特点,可以选择不同的算法进行建模。常见的模型选择方法包括监督学习、无监督学习、半监督学习和强化学习等。
监督学习是指在有标签的数据上进行训练,学习输入与输出之间的映射关系。常见的监督学习算法包括线性回归、逻辑回归、支持向量机、决策树、随机森林、神经网络等。在化工行业中,监督学习可以用于产品质量预测、故障诊断、工艺优化等任务。
无监督学习是指在无标签的数据上进行训练,发现数据中的模式和结构。常见的无监督学习算法包括聚类分析、主成分分析、关联规则挖掘等。在化工行业中,无监督学习可以用于客户分群、市场细分、异常检测等任务。
半监督学习是介于监督学习和无监督学习之间的一种方法,利用少量的标签数据和大量的无标签数据进行训练。常见的半监督学习算法包括自训练、共训练、图半监督学习等。在化工行业中,半监督学习可以用于标签数据稀缺的场景,如新产品的质量预测、新市场的客户分类等。
强化学习是指通过与环境的交互,不断学习最优策略的方法。常见的强化学习算法包括Q学习、策略梯度、深度强化学习等。在化工行业中,强化学习可以用于生产过程的优化控制、智能调度、机器人操作等任务。
五、结果分析
结果分析是对模型的输出进行解释和评估,以验证模型的有效性和实用性。在化工行业的数据挖掘分析中,结果分析可以帮助我们了解生产过程中的关键因素、发现潜在的问题、优化生产工艺等。
结果分析的方法主要包括定量分析和定性分析两类。定量分析是通过统计指标和图表对模型的输出进行评估,如准确率、召回率、F1值、ROC曲线、混淆矩阵等。定性分析是通过专家知识和领域经验对模型的输出进行解释和验证,如特征重要性、决策树路径、规则可视化等。
在化工行业的数据挖掘分析中,可以通过定量分析评估模型的性能,如产品质量预测的准确率、故障诊断的召回率、工艺优化的收益等;通过定性分析解释模型的输出,如影响产品质量的关键因素、导致设备故障的原因、优化工艺的路径等。
六、优化
优化是根据分析结果,对生产工艺、流程等进行调整和改进,以提高生产效率和产品质量。在化工行业的数据挖掘分析中,优化是实现数据价值的关键一步。
优化的方法主要包括参数优化、工艺优化和流程优化等。参数优化是指通过调整生产过程中的参数,提高生产效率和产品质量,如反应温度、压力、流量等。工艺优化是指通过改进生产工艺,提高产品的性能和质量,如反应路径、原料配比、催化剂选择等。流程优化是指通过优化生产流程,提高生产的整体效率和效益,如设备布局、物流调度、资源配置等。
在化工行业的数据挖掘分析中,可以通过优化实现多方面的改进。例如,通过参数优化,可以提高化学反应的转化率、降低副产物的生成;通过工艺优化,可以提高产品的纯度、降低生产成本;通过流程优化,可以提高生产的灵活性、减少生产的停机时间等。
通过数据挖掘分析和优化,化工行业可以实现智能化、精细化、绿色化生产,提高企业的核心竞争力和可持续发展能力。借助于先进的数据挖掘工具和平台,如FineBI,可以显著提高数据分析的效率和效果。FineBI是帆软旗下的一款数据分析工具,具有强大的数据处理和分析功能,适用于各种行业的数据挖掘分析需求。
F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
化工行业数据挖掘分析的目的是什么?
化工行业数据挖掘分析的主要目的是通过对大量数据的深入分析,识别出潜在的模式、趋势和相关性,从而为企业的决策提供有力支持。化工行业涉及复杂的生产过程、供应链管理、市场需求和环境影响等多个方面,数据挖掘能够帮助企业优化生产流程、降低成本、提升产品质量、预测市场需求以及提高整体运营效率。
在化工行业中,数据来源广泛,包括生产设备的传感器数据、实验室测试结果、市场调研数据、客户反馈及销售数据等。通过对这些数据进行清洗、整合和分析,企业能够识别出潜在的生产瓶颈、产品质量问题和市场机会。此外,数据挖掘还可以帮助企业进行风险评估和管理,尤其是在面对市场波动和原材料价格变动时。
化工行业数据挖掘分析的常用方法有哪些?
在化工行业中,数据挖掘分析采用多种方法和技术,以满足不同的分析需求。以下是一些常用的方法:
-
聚类分析:聚类分析用于将数据集分成多个组,以发现数据中的自然分布和结构。在化工行业中,可以用于客户细分、市场分析及生产过程的优化。例如,通过对生产数据进行聚类分析,可以识别出高效的生产参数组合,从而提高产量和降低能耗。
-
回归分析:回归分析用于建立变量之间的关系模型。在化工行业,回归分析能够帮助企业预测产品的市场需求、生产成本或质量指标。例如,通过分析过去的销售数据,企业可以预测未来的销量,从而更好地进行生产计划。
-
时间序列分析:时间序列分析用于处理随时间变化的数据,帮助企业识别趋势和季节性变化。在化工行业,这种分析方法尤其适用于需求预测和库存管理。通过分析历史销售数据,企业可以制定更合理的生产和库存策略。
-
关联规则挖掘:关联规则挖掘用于发现数据中不同变量之间的关联关系。在化工行业,可以用于分析产品组合销售、客户购买行为等。例如,企业可以根据客户的购买记录,识别出常常一起购买的化学品,从而在促销活动中进行搭配销售。
-
文本挖掘:文本挖掘用于从非结构化数据中提取有价值的信息。在化工行业,企业可以分析客户反馈、市场调研报告和社交媒体评论,以了解客户需求和市场趋势。这种方法可以帮助企业更好地了解市场动态,及时调整产品和服务。
如何进行化工行业数据挖掘分析的实施步骤?
实施化工行业数据挖掘分析通常包括以下几个关键步骤:
-
明确目标:在开始数据挖掘之前,企业需要明确分析的目标和问题。不同的目标可能需要不同的数据和分析方法。例如,企业可能希望通过数据挖掘来提高生产效率,或者希望通过市场分析来识别新的商业机会。
-
数据收集:收集与分析目标相关的数据。化工行业的数据来源多样,包括生产监控系统、ERP系统、市场调查、客户反馈等。企业需要确保数据的完整性和准确性,以便后续分析的有效性。
-
数据预处理:在进行数据分析之前,需要对数据进行清洗和预处理。数据清洗的过程包括去除重复数据、填补缺失值、纠正错误数据等。此外,数据预处理还可能涉及数据规范化和标准化,以便不同来源的数据能够进行有效比较。
-
选择合适的分析方法:根据明确的目标和预处理后的数据,选择合适的数据挖掘方法和工具。不同的方法适用于不同类型的数据和分析目标,企业需要根据具体情况进行选择。
-
数据分析与建模:使用选择的方法对数据进行分析。根据分析的结果构建模型,以帮助企业做出决策。在这一过程中,可能需要多次迭代,以优化模型的准确性和有效性。
-
结果解释与应用:分析完成后,企业需要对结果进行解释和应用。将分析结果转化为可操作的建议,以支持企业的决策过程。结果的可视化也是重要的一环,可以帮助相关人员更直观地理解数据分析的结果。
-
反馈与改进:实施数据挖掘分析后,企业应根据实际应用情况进行反馈和改进。定期评估数据挖掘的效果,持续优化数据分析流程,以提高数据分析的效率和准确性。
通过以上步骤,化工企业能够有效地利用数据挖掘技术,提升决策的科学性和准确性,从而在竞争日益激烈的市场中获得优势。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



